Aristotle’s logic, especially his theory of the syllogism, has had an unparalleled influence on the history of western thought. It did not always hold this position: in the hellenistic period, stoic logic, and in particular the work of chrysippus, took pride of place.

Mental process (how the gears work) is not the proper concern of logic, but of psychology or neurophysiology. The proper concern of logic is whether the infer-ence of c on the basis of p 1, p2, p3, is warranted (correct). Inferences are made on the basis of variou s sorts of things – data, facts, infor-mation, states of affairs.

A logic model presents a picture of how your effort or initiative is supposed to work. It explains why your strategy is a good solution to the problem at hand. Effective logic models make an explicit, often visual, statement of the activities that will bring about change and the results you expect to see for the community and its people.

Propositional logic, also known as sentential logic and statement logic, is the branch of logic that studies ways of joining and/or modifying entire propositions, statements or sentences to form more complicated propositions, statements or sentences, as well as the logical relationships and properties that are derived from these methods of combining or altering statements.

The most familiar logics in the modal family are constructed from a weak logic called \(\bk\) (after saul kripke). Under the narrow reading, modal logic concerns necessity and possibility. A variety of different systems may be developed for such logics using \(\bk\) as a foundation.
